UK and EU Heavy Metal Limits and Compliance Risks

Heavy metal contamination in packaging materials is a critical compliance area that can lead to severe financial and legal repercussions. The UK Packaging (Essential Requirements) Regulations 2015 establish a strict limit of 100 parts per million (ppm) for the combined concentration of cadmium, mercury, lead, and hexavalent chromium in any packaging component. Exceeding these limits can result in substantial fines, product recalls, and, in certain instances, criminal proceedings.

The financial impact of a breach often extends far beyond the initial penalty. Contaminated packaging batches must be destroyed or reprocessed, leading to significant waste disposal costs and disruptions in e-commerce fulfilment. For businesses importing void fill, particularly from regions with different manufacturing standards, regular batch testing is a necessary step to ensure compliance. Because the 100ppm limit applies to the total packaging system, a single non-compliant void fill product can compromise the legal status of an entire shipment.

Requirements Under Current UK Packaging Regulations

1. Minimum Weight and Volume Standards

Current UK legislation mandates that packaging must be designed to the minimum weight and volume necessary to maintain product safety and hygiene. This requirement directly influences void fill selection; companies cannot use excessive cushioning without technical justification. The regulation encourages businesses to demonstrate that their chosen material provides the required protection without exceeding reasonable volume thresholds. This is particularly relevant for e-commerce operations, where the goal of customer satisfaction through robust padding must be balanced against legal mandates for material reduction.

2. Heavy Metal Concentration Verification

The 100ppm limit is a non-negotiable standard for all materials entering the UK market. Verification protocols vary depending on the material's origin, with imported products often requiring more rigorous documentation. Specialists in the field recommend that procurement managers establish clear testing protocols to verify compliance before materials enter the supply chain. Maintaining certificates of analysis for all mailing supplies and void fill products is essential, as these records must be available for regulatory inspection at any point in the distribution process.

3. Recyclability and Recovery Design

UK regulations require that packaging intended for recycling must incorporate materials that can be effectively processed through existing waste recovery systems. For void fill, this involves selecting options that do not contaminate recycling streams. While paper-based void fills typically meet these standards, certain biodegradable options may require specific industrial composting facilities that are not yet universally available in every UK region. Furthermore, void fill materials must not interfere with the recyclability of the primary packaging; for instance, adhesives that bond permanently to cardboard boxes can render the entire package non-recyclable.

New EU Packaging Regulation Changes (PPWR)

50% Maximum Empty Space Requirement

The EU Packaging and Packaging Waste Regulation introduces a 50% maximum empty space requirement for transport and e-commerce packaging, set to take effect by January 2030. This fundamentally alters the approach to packaging design, shifting the focus from simply filling gaps to optimising the internal volume of every parcel. For businesses shipping to the EU, this requires a sophisticated packaging strategy that utilizes multiple box sizes or automated systems to ensure that void fill does not occupy more than half of the total volume.

Universal Recyclability Deadline

By January 2030, all packaging placed on the EU market must be recyclable through established infrastructure. This deadline effectively phases out many traditional materials, such as expanded polystyrene (EPS) and certain non-standard plastics. This shift favours sustainable void fill materials like paper, which integrate into current recycling systems without additional processing. However, businesses must ensure that these materials remain recyclable even when in contact with shipping residues like moisture or adhesive tape.

UK Extended Producer Responsibility and Plastic Packaging Tax

EPR Fee Modulation

Extended Producer Responsibility (EPR) schemes hold businesses financially accountable for the entire lifecycle of their packaging. In the UK, EPR fees are modulated based on recyclability performance. Materials that are difficult to recycle or that compromise the quality of recycled streams incur higher fees, while easily recyclable materials benefit from lower charges. This creates a direct financial incentive to choose paper-based or high-quality recyclable void fill. These ongoing costs can eventually outweigh the initial purchase price of cheaper, non-compliant materials.

The Plastic Packaging Tax

The UK Plastic Packaging Tax applies to plastic packaging containing less than 30% recycled content. This applies to both domestically produced and imported materials. For businesses using plastic air pillows or foam, achieving the 30% threshold is mandatory to avoid tax penalties. Choosing alternative materials, such as starch-based peanuts or paper padding, removes this tax burden entirely, simplifying compliance and reducing overall procurement costs.

Expert-Recommended Eco-Friendly Solutions

Paper-Based Systems

Paper-based materials have become the preferred compliance solution for many UK businesses. Options such as the Speedman box system use 100% recycled and recyclable paper, providing robust protection while supporting circular economy goals. These materials compress efficiently, reducing storage requirements and lowering the carbon footprint associated with logistics. Because they are widely accepted in kerbside recycling, they help businesses meet both consumer expectations and EPR requirements.

EN 13432 Certified Biodegradable Options

Starch-based packing peanuts, such as Ecoflo, offer a 100% compostable alternative to traditional foam peanuts. These materials are certified under the EN 13432 standard, meaning they biodegrade naturally without leaving toxic residues in soil or water. They are particularly effective for businesses shipping fragile items that require an interlocking structure for shock absorption. Recipients can dispose of these materials via organic waste streams or simply dissolve them in water, providing a high-quality "unboxing" experience that highlights the brand's environmental commitment.

High-Performance Air Cushions

While not always biodegradable, modern air cushion systems like Opus Bio are manufactured from plant-based materials and are fully recyclable. Their primary sustainability benefit lies in their extreme lightness; by minimising the weight of the parcel, they reduce fuel consumption during transit. This makes them an ideal choice for businesses looking to lower their scope 3 emissions while maintaining a high level of impact protection for delicate electronics or glassware.

Implementing a Compliant Packaging Strategy

Transitioning to compliant void fill solutions involves an initial investment in material testing and staff training, but industry data suggests that these costs are often offset by improved packing efficiency and reduced penalty risks. Successful transitions typically begin with a comprehensive audit of current materials against UK and EU standards.

Key steps for procurement managers include:

  • Auditing Material Specs: Verify heavy metal levels and recycled content percentages with suppliers.
  • Space Optimisation: Review box sizes to ensure compliance with the upcoming 50% empty space rule.
  • Disposal Guidance: Ensure end-users are provided with clear instructions on how to recycle or compost the void fill.

Industry specialists note that businesses acting ahead of legislative deadlines often secure more favourable pricing from sustainable material suppliers and build stronger customer loyalty.

Achieving compliance requires a proactive approach to material selection and volume management. By integrating paper-based or certified biodegradable materials into their operations, UK businesses can satisfy legal requirements, avoid the Plastic Packaging Tax, and reduce their EPR obligations.
